The turnstile counter API at Bramblefield Arena is pretty simple: each gate posts an increment event, and the `/counts` endpoint gives you live totals per entrance. Numbers reset at midnight local time, so don't panic if a late query looks low. Polling more than once per second gets you throttled. To call the counts endpoint from the ops network, authenticate with the key below.

service key, fawip-bajef: kto11_Qt5wZK9vdNC

The user module is splitting out of the Hollowgate monolith into a standalone service, Persona. During migration, the monolith proxies /users calls to Persona; responses are byte-identical, latency adds ~8ms. Writes dual-commit until cutover next sprint. Rollback is a single flag flip. The proxy layer authenticates to Persona through the internal Gatestone broker using the key below.

gateway credential: kto23_LX9A4ys6i4nzHtpOLNLodKK

Present: J. Marholt (Chair), F. Essien, K. Druvall, and the finance leads. The meeting reviewed the draft joint venture with Tannerling Systems covering the proposed Bravelle logistics platform. Capital contributions would be split 60/40, with board seats allocated accordingly. Finance raised questions on working-capital commitments in year one and the treatment of shared IP; Tannerling's counsel will respond within two weeks. A go/no-go decision is scheduled for the next session. The confidential strategic position is recorded below.

management briefing: Jorixax Holdings is in early talks to buy Casixax Holdings for about $420.3 million. The Fenmir launch date is October 27, and nothing goes to the press before then. Legal wants the Keloxek Foods term sheet redrafted before April 16.

## Formula sandbox tuning

User-supplied formulas in Gridmoor execute inside a restricted interpreter with hard ceilings on time, memory, and call depth. Reviewers should confirm any change to these ceilings is justified in the PR description, since raising them widens the abuse surface. Defaults were chosen from production traces. The current limits are as follows.

limits module of tafog-fawip:
WEIGHTS = {
    "julix": 57,
    "lamys": 992,
    "kasvan": 209,
    "quenok": 750,
    "alddor": 259,
    "oliath": 1009,
    "wenix": 815,
}